Ireland’s energy-related emissions has reached their lowest in 30 years

Ireland’s energy-related emissions were down 8.3 per cent in 2023 to its lowest figure in 30 years – but there must be a faster rate of change if we want to meet our legally binding climate commitments.  

So says the Sustainable Energy Authority of Ireland, Margie McCarthy, Director of Research and Policy Insights with the Sustainable Energy Authority of Ireland.
